Corporate Actions Administrator

3 weeks ago


London, United Kingdom Sophisticated Recruitment Full time

Sophisticated Recruitment are working with a well known investment manager to hire a corporate actions administrator.

**Aim & purpose of the role**:
The prime requirement of this role is to ensure the accurate and timely processing of both mandatory and voluntary Corporate Actions. Also providing support to the Investment Managers and clients while liaising with various custodians.

**Key accountabilities/responsibilities**
- Identify and process all Corporate Actions such as Rights Issues, Open Offers, Redemptions, Bonus Issues, Scheme of Arrangements, Conversions, Takeovers, IPO/Placings, AGM & Proxy Voting, S793 & SRDII etc. and ensuring clients are informed ahead of deadlines
- Process IPO and Book Builds
- Dealing with enquiries from Investment Managers and liaising with multiple Custodians to reconcile and provide updates on Corporate Events
- Accurately entering and maintaining records on Internal Systems
- Ensure client Valuation and Custody records are accurately updated and in a timely manner to comply with CASS rules
- Drafting of departmental procedures and ongoing ownership of those procedures
- Challenge existing processes and recommend and implement changes, resulting in improving service quality, process efficiency and reduction in risk
- Participation in key departmental projects and undertake any additional Operational tasks when requested by the Line Manager/Senior Management
